Oh, the cowl vents do serve a purpose. If you dont have AC they supply the fresh air for your floor vents. No big deal...roll the window down dummy! They do not affect the heater. There is plenty of air to be scavaged to make the heater blow. There is an outside air vent behind the fenders so that takes care of that problem.
